Midnight's Whisper: The Enchanted Labyrinth
In the heart of the ancient kingdom of Aeloria, where the stars weep tears of moonlight, there lay a labyrinth known as the Whispering Woods. It was said that those who dared to enter its depths would find not only a challenge but also the answers to their deepest desires. For two souls, the labyrinth was more than a mere quest—it was their fate.
Elarion, a young and handsome knight, had been chosen by the fates to seek the heart of the labyrinth. His heart, however, was not in the quest but in the arms of a man, Lysander, a sorcerer whose power was as enigmatic as his presence. Their love was forbidden, their union a sin in the eyes of the kingdom, yet their passion was as unyielding as the stone walls of the labyrinth.
The night of the quest, Elarion stood at the entrance, his eyes reflecting the moonlight that filtered through the gnarled branches above. "Lysander," he whispered, "I must go. I must find the heart of the labyrinth."
Lysander, a man of few words but profound emotions, stepped forward. "Remember, Elarion, the heart of the labyrinth is not a place but a person. It is the one who holds the key to your soul."
Elarion nodded, his heart heavy with the weight of his love and the duty he felt. With a final, tender kiss, he turned and stepped into the labyrinth, the path ahead shrouded in shadows and mystery.
The labyrinth was a maze of twisted corridors and shifting walls, each turn more disorienting than the last. Elarion moved with a sense of purpose, his mind filled with thoughts of Lysander. Yet, as he delved deeper, the labyrinth began to change, the walls shifting and the air thickening with an otherworldly energy.
Suddenly, a voice echoed through the labyrinth, a voice that was both familiar and alien. "You seek the heart of the labyrinth, but do you truly know what you are looking for?"
Elarion stopped, his heart pounding. "I seek the one who can complete me, the one who holds the key to my soul."
The voice chuckled, a sound that sent shivers down his spine. "And who, pray tell, is this person?"
Elarion took a deep breath, knowing the truth must be spoken. "Lysander."
The voice fell silent for a moment, then replied, "Very well, Elarion. You seek Lysander, but the labyrinth has a trick for you. To find him, you must become him."
Confused and wary, Elarion pressed on, the labyrinth's walls closing in around him. The path became clearer, and soon he found himself standing before a mirror. In it, he saw not himself but Lysander, his eyes filled with the same love and longing that Elarion felt.
With a gasp, Elarion stepped forward, merging with the image of Lysander. The labyrinth around him seemed to shimmer, and he found himself standing in a clearing bathed in moonlight. There, standing before him, was Lysander, his face alight with joy and surprise.
"Lysander," Elarion whispered, "I am here."
Lysander smiled, tears of joy streaming down his face. "I knew you would come. The labyrinth has tested us, but it has brought us together."
The labyrinth began to crumble around them, the walls dissolving into mist. Elarion and Lysander held each other, their love as boundless as the night sky above.
As the last of the labyrinth faded away, the kingdom of Aeloria awoke to find the Whispering Woods gone, replaced by a tranquil forest where the air was filled with the soft hum of love. The people spoke of the knight and the sorcerer who had vanquished the labyrinth and brought peace to their land, and their love became a legend that would be told for generations.
Elarion and Lysander, now united, lived out their days in the heart of the tranquil forest, their love an eternal flame that defied all boundaries and time. The labyrinth's whisper had spoken true: love, in its purest form, was the key to the heart of the labyrinth, and it was love that had freed them both.
